The Influence of Oral-Cued Retell Strategy in Teaching Students’ Speaking Skill ( An Experimental Research at first Grade of MA ANNIDA Islamic Boarding School Jayanti Kab.Tangerang Banten ) Speaking using foreign language well, especially English is still a problem for some students / language learners in Indonesia, especially for students in first Grade of MA ANNIDA Islamic Boarding School Jayanti Kab.Tangerang Banten. They are still confused and the biggest problem of students is less of confidence in using and practicing English. This research is to determine whether the students’ speaking skill can be improved by using Oral-Cued Retell Strategy or not. The researcher used Quantitative Research with Quasi-experiment type to determine the influence of Oral-cued retell strategy in teaching students’ speaking skill. This is involved two classes (experimental class and control class), each class consist of thirtieth students. Then from findings above, it can be concluded that Oral-cued retell strategy has an influence in improving students’ speaking skill especially students become more interested and more confident in practicing their daily English. The result of this research shows that the students speaking abilities who use cued retell strategy achieve better performance than those who do not use Oral-cued retell strategy The result of the data analysis is using t-test the value of is 5,27, the degree of freedom 58. In the degree significance 5% = 1,67 in degree of significance 1% = 2,39. After that the writer compared the data with (t table) both in degree significance 5% and 1%. Therefore = 5,27 > 1,67 in degree of significance 5% and = 5,27 > 2,39 in degree significance 1%. is bigger than it means there is significance effect of using Oral-cued retell strategy to improve students’ speaking skill.
